Linton is a city located in Emmons County, North Dakota. Linton has a 2025 population of 1,034 . Linton is currently declining at a rate of -0.58% annually and its population has decreased by -2.82%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 1,064 in 2020.
The average household income in Linton is $65,343 with a poverty rate of 10.68%. The median age in Linton is 55.9 years: 54.8 years for males, and 57.5 years for females. For every 100 females there are 94.0 males.

The racial composition of Linton includes 88.06% White, 3.1% Native American, and smaller percentages for Asian and multiracial populations.

Linton's average per capita income is $45,074. Household income levels show a median of $50,833. The poverty rate stands at 10.68%.
